Computer system for authoring a multimedia composition using a visual representation of the multimedia composition

First Claim
Patent Images

1. A computer system having a graphical user interface for use in authoring a multimedia composition having one or more multimedia events, the computer system having a processor and a display screen coupled to the processor and an input device for receiving input from an author, the computer system comprising:

  • means for defining and displaying through the graphical user interface a representation of a first multimedia composition including a first start position which indicates a beginning of the first multimedia composition, a first end position which indicates an end of the first multimedia composition and a first unidirectional path line connecting the first start position and the first end position,means for defining and displaying through the graphical user interface a representation of a second multimedia composition including a second start position which indicates a beginning of the second multimedia composition, a second end position which indicates an end of the second multimedia composition, and a second unidirectional path line connecting the second start position and the second end positions, andmeans, responsive to input from the input device, for defining and displaying through the graphical user interface a link between the first and the second unidirectional path lines, wherein the displayed link includes a representation of at least one multimedia event shared by the first and second multimedia compositions, such that the first and second multimedia compositions may be played independent of each other.
